Does the battery get damaged if my macbook's power adapter is always connected?

I was wandering about the battery life of my new macbook pro. If when i'm at home i always connect the macbook to the power adapter, does it affect the battery?

Possible.


You have to run the MacBook Pro on battery once in a while to keep the battery in good condition.


Keep the computer plugged in whenever possible.


If you keep the computer always plugged in, make sure that at least twice a month


run it on battery until battery level drops to about 50-40%.
